In order to start making money online, you should take the adventure as a real business and not a quick money making scheme. Being penniless and without a job is not the best moment to start an online or off-line business.

Money needs to be spent as an investment so any business can be initiated. Most of the people believe that everything on the Internet is free. They think that they can use a bunch of free resources to get started.

The drawback with those free resources is that the marketer is not in the driver's seat. Any free account someone has, may be suspended at any time for some reasons: policy violation, service terminated or changed to a paid upgrade.

You have to understand that you are not going to make any money by joining a free program. That is the hook to get you in the door so they can sell you other things once they get you in the door.

There are many newbie Internet marketers that use free hosting, free domain registration, free auto-responder, free advertising, and the list goes on. These marketers will understand some time later, when one of their free account has been canceled, that all the work they have put into making and promoting their website is for almost nothing!

You may have not spent a dime but you have lost your time, and time is money! You have worked for nothing!

Making significant money online takes much more skills and work than one would think. It takes having some structure to your daily schedule of tasks.

The good news with Internet marketing is that a business can be started at any time with a minimal budget. Having a job, with a regular salary, is the best when time can be used after work or in the week-end to begin slowly, without worrying about money.

With a small monthly allowance kept for the online business and time spent to study how Internet marketing works, moving forward is possible with down-to-earth goals. Fortunately, starting a business online is cheap.

The main expenses that the new marketer would have are: domain name registration, a web hosting plan and a paid auto-responder system. In addition to that, some budget may be needed to outsource work that can't be done by oneself such as web or graphic design and writing articles.
